M.Ch.-Master of Chirurgiae
Ph.D. ยท Neuro Surgery
M.Ch.-Master of Chirurgiae is a Ph.D.-level programme in Neuro Surgery, offered by 54 institutes across 22 states in India, as recorded in AISHE data. Combined approved seat intake across all institutes offering this programme is 704 students per year. Duration is 1 to 3 years.
